HOW WE KEEP YOUR DATA SECURE?

We adopt industry standard security processes to ensure your data is kept safe and secure and to prevent unauthorized access or use or loss of your data. By way of example, we use secure server software (EV SSL), which encrypts all information you input before it is sent to us. We also make sure that third parties who need to handle your data when helping us to deliver our services are subject to suitable confidentiality and security standards. Despite the security measures we implement, please be aware that the transmission of data via the Internet is not completely secure. As such, we cannot guarantee that information transmitted to us via the Internet will be completely secure and any transmission is at your own risk.

YOUR RIGHTS.

In certain situations, you are entitled to:

  • access a copy of your personal data;
  • correct or update your personal data, which you can do yourself by logging into your account or if you would prefer, please contact us and we can help you out;
  • erase your personal data;
  • Object to the processing of your personal data where we are relying on a legitimate interest (as set out in the above table);
  • Restrict the processing of your personal data;
  • Request the transfer of your personal data to a third party; or

If you want to exercise any of these rights, please contact us. You don’t have to pay a fee to exercise your rights, unless your request is clearly unfounded, repetitive or excessive (in which case we can charge a reasonable fee). Alternatively, we may refuse to comply with your request in these circumstances. Where your request is legitimate, we will always respond within one month (unless there is a legal reason to take longer, such as where your request is particularly complex). We may also need you to confirm your identity before we proceed with your request if it is not clear to us who is making the request. In addition to the above, you may get in touch with the ICO (Information Commissioner’s Office) if you are concerned about the way in which we are handling your personal data.
